Coachella is one of the most popular music and art festivals in the world. It is held annually at the Empire Polo Club in Indio, California. The festival features many different genres of music, including rock, hip-hop, EDM, pop, and punk. It also features many visual and performing arts, including contemporary art installations, sculptures, and special effects. The festival has been held since 1999, and it has grown in popularity over the years. So why is Coachella so good?
